Well made canvas art
These are really well made, while the frame is light its not thin wood and looks durable. The images are crisp and have a vibrance to them. They came well packaged with plastic around each one for protection. All in all they look great!

They're not bad, but just lack oomph.
These are 3 pieces, on stretched, printed canvas. They're glossy, like they've been painted, but they also have a look reminiscent of clip-art, if it was done in a sumi-e style. They don't look *bad*, but they have no real personality, in my uneducated opinion.This is of course a problem with commercial art in general, in a philosophical sense, but literally if you don't own a katana you're not gonna love these a whole ton. They're the one thing that doesn't make any sense that I have on my walls, and I don't even hate them.Honestly, the one with the guy facing away really reminds me of the classic PS title with a ghost samurai, and that's why I like it, except he's holding the katana the wrong direction for some reason. It might be a wakizashi, technically; I'm not an expert, but I know they didn't hold 'em like that all the time.These are okay. If you're looking to satisfy a craving for edge, you've got it.
